Members of the Arab Poets International Association and members of the Syrian Writers and Poets Union came together within the scope of the “Spring of Rhymes - Fifth Period” events organized by Bülbülzade Foundation, Migrant Services Center and Gaziantep Syrian Community.
Poetry recitals, hymns and various cultural activities were organized in the meeting that reinforced cultural unity. Turgay Aldemir, President of Bülbülzade Foundation, who made the greeting speech in the program, said: "You were the silent cry of Syria. Until today, you poured the pain into verses. From now on, it is time to talk about the future, children, and reconstruction freely in our own lands, under the sky. We are all responsible for ensuring that this situation in Syria does not regress. It is time to write and speak for the future of Syria, Bilad al-Sham, Jerusalem and oppressed people. We will live in freedom and brotherhood by loving each other and healing the wounds, by saying that if the other's wound heals, our wound will heal."
The program, held at Çetin Emeç Hall of Gaziantep Metropolitan Municipality, ended after the presentation of a plaque of appreciation for the contribution and support shown.
